Rockland Daily: Congressman Lawler Announces 2025 Town Hall Schedule
By Rockland Daily Staff ,
March 11, 2025
U.S. Congressman Mike Lawler, representing New York’s 17th Congressional District, has announced a series of town hall meetings across the Hudson Valley for 2025. The events are scheduled for April in Rockland County, May in Westchester, and June in both Putnam and Dutchess counties, providing constituents an opportunity to engage directly with the representative. Lawler shared the news in a post on X, stating, “I’m excited to announce we have four upcoming town halls across the district over the next 3 months! These events are an opportunity for you to share your thoughts, ask questions, and hear about the work I’m doing in Washington and here at home. I look forward to seeing you there and hearing from you!” Further details, including specific dates and times, will be released in the coming weeks, according to the congressman’s office. The announcement comes as Republicans in Congress are facing increasing scrutiny from constituents, following reports from leadership to not do town halls. This once again shows Congressman Lawler’s independence and willingness to buck party leadership to engage with his constituents. Congressman Lawler previously stated on X, in response to a post calling him a “missing Congressman, stated “I’ve done over 1200 in-district, in-person events since becoming a member of Congress, including over 50 in-person town hall and mobile office hour meetings and we just announced upcoming town halls. Since Thursday night, I’ve done 11 events and meetings across the district.” |
